Application:
1. Power plants (thermal and nuclear power plants)—this is the largest and most classic application area for C6872T copper tubes.
Condensers: Condensing exhaust steam from steam turbines into water, creating a vacuum and improving power generation efficiency.
2. Shipbuilding and marine engineering
Various central coolers, lubricating oil coolers, and air coolers
Seawater cooling systems for offshore oil drilling platforms
3. Desalination plants
Modern desalination technologies are primarily divided into multi-stage flash evaporation and reverse osmosis.
4. Chemical and process industries
Seawater-cooled heat exchangers.
